PRAGMATIC ADVISORS, LLC is registered as a limited liability company in the United States, functioning as a single-family office. The firm maintains no public website and discloses no leadership team, founding date, or originating wealth source in commercial registries, which is a common posture for family offices prioritizing confidentiality over public capital formation. Without disclosed mandates, the firm's investment approach can be inferred from the typical architecture of privacy-maximizing single-family offices. These structures often allocate across public equities via separately managed accounts, fixed income for capital preservation, and private market exposure — including direct private equity, venture capital fund commitments, and real estate — to match long-duration liabilities. Geographic focus is presumed to be domestic, with potential co-investment relationships cultivated through a closed network of peer family offices, investment banks, and independent sponsors. Team size, total deployment, and adjacent philanthropic or operating vehicles remain entirely private. No regulatory filings providing a breakdown of assets under management or specific portfolio company positions are available. The firm has not announced any fund closes, strategic hires, or office expansions in the public domain. Structurally, PRAGMATIC ADVISORS represents the archetype of the silent single-family office — relying on closed-network deal sourcing and institutional custodians rather than public-facing capital-raising. The entity's primary differentiator is its posture of deliberate opacity, which itself functions as a competitive filter by reducing unsolicited deal flow and public scrutiny.

Frequently asked questions

How does PRAGMATIC ADVISORS source its investment opportunities?

Based on its lack of public-facing infrastructure, PRAGMATIC ADVISORS likely sources opportunities through closed professional networks common to single-family offices, such as referrals from private banks, independent sponsors, law firms, and other family offices. The firm's absence from conference circuits and co-investment platforms indicates a reliance on curated, relationship-driven deal flow rather than broad auction processes.

Is PRAGMATIC ADVISORS structured as a single-family office or a multi-family office?

The firm's name, PRAGMATIC ADVISORS, LLC, combined with its total lack of publicly disclosed marketing materials or regulatory filings, is consistent with a single-family office structure. Multi-family offices typically maintain a website and a public-facing brand to attract additional client families, which this firm does not.

Does PRAGMATIC ADVISORS manage capital for external investors?

No public record indicates that PRAGMATIC ADVISORS accepts outside capital. The absence of marketing materials, SEC-registered investment advisor public disclosures, or any solicitation of LPs supports that the firm exclusively manages capital for a single family.

Where does the underlying wealth for PRAGMATIC ADVISORS originate?

The originating source of the family's wealth is not publicly disclosed. Many single-family offices choose never to publicize the identity of their principal or the source of their capital, particularly when wealth was generated through private company sales or industries where the family prefers to maintain a low public profile.

What is PRAGMATIC ADVISORS' posture on co-investments alongside external managers?

The firm's stance on co-investments is unknown due to the absence of public deal announcements or fund involvement. Typically, a family office of this level of privacy would evaluate co-investment opportunities on a selective basis, offered by existing trusted fund managers or peer family offices, rather than institutional open-invitation co-investment programs.
